| /vim-8.2.3635/src/libvterm/src/ |
| H A D | parser.c | 15 if(vt->parser.callbacks && vt->parser.callbacks->control) in do_control() 16 if((*vt->parser.callbacks->control)(control, vt->parser.cbdata)) in do_control() 35 if(vt->parser.callbacks && vt->parser.callbacks->csi) in do_csi() 40 vt->parser.intermedlen ? vt->parser.intermed : NULL, in do_csi() 57 if(vt->parser.callbacks && vt->parser.callbacks->escape) in do_escape() 75 if(vt->parser.callbacks && vt->parser.callbacks->osc) in string_fragment() 76 (*vt->parser.callbacks->osc)(vt->parser.v.osc.command, frag, vt->parser.cbdata); in string_fragment() 81 …(*vt->parser.callbacks->dcs)(vt->parser.v.dcs.command, vt->parser.v.dcs.commandlen, frag, vt->pars… in string_fragment() 209 vt->parser.v.csi.args[vt->parser.v.csi.argi] = 0; in vterm_input_write() 210 vt->parser.v.csi.args[vt->parser.v.csi.argi] *= 10; in vterm_input_write() [all …]
|
| H A D | vterm.c | 63 vt->outbuffer = vterm_allocator_malloc(vt, vt->outbuffer_len); in vterm_new_with_allocator() 66 vt->tmpbuffer = vterm_allocator_malloc(vt, vt->tmpbuffer_len); in vterm_new_with_allocator() 72 vterm_allocator_free(vt, vt->outbuffer); in vterm_new_with_allocator() 73 vterm_allocator_free(vt, vt->tmpbuffer); in vterm_new_with_allocator() 74 vterm_allocator_free(vt, vt); in vterm_new_with_allocator() 89 vterm_allocator_free(vt, vt->outbuffer); in vterm_free() 90 vterm_allocator_free(vt, vt->tmpbuffer); in vterm_free() 92 vterm_allocator_free(vt, vt); in vterm_free() 106 (*vt->allocator->free)(ptr, vt->allocdata); in vterm_allocator_free() 145 (vt->outfunc)(bytes, len, vt->outdata); in vterm_push_output_bytes() [all …]
|
| H A D | keyboard.c | 7 int vterm_is_modify_other_keys(VTerm *vt) in vterm_is_modify_other_keys() argument 9 return vt->state->mode.modify_other_keys; in vterm_is_modify_other_keys() 32 vterm_push_output_bytes(vt, str, seqlen); in vterm_keyboard_unichar() 180 if(vt->state->mode.newline) in vterm_keyboard_key() 181 vterm_push_output_sprintf(vt, "\r\n"); in vterm_keyboard_key() 215 if(vt->state->mode.cursor) in vterm_keyboard_key() 221 if(vt->state->mode.keypad) { in vterm_keyboard_key() 230 void vterm_keyboard_start_paste(VTerm *vt) in vterm_keyboard_start_paste() argument 232 if(vt->state->mode.bracketpaste) in vterm_keyboard_start_paste() 236 void vterm_keyboard_end_paste(VTerm *vt) in vterm_keyboard_end_paste() argument [all …]
|
| H A D | state.c | 68 state->vt = vt; in vterm_state_new() 70 state->rows = vt->rows; in vterm_state_new() 71 state->cols = vt->cols; in vterm_state_new() 375 state->vt->in_backspace -= (state->vt->in_backspace > 0) ? 1 : 0; in on_text() 1670 VTerm *vt = state->vt; in request_status_string() local 1695 cur += SNPRINTF(vt->tmpbuffer + cur, vt->tmpbuffer_len - cur, in request_status_string() 1701 cur += SNPRINTF(vt->tmpbuffer + cur, vt->tmpbuffer_len - cur, in request_status_string() 1710 cur += SNPRINTF(vt->tmpbuffer + cur, vt->tmpbuffer_len - cur, in request_status_string() 1715 vterm_push_output_bytes(vt, vt->tmpbuffer, cur); in request_status_string() 1879 if(vt->state) in vterm_obtain_state() [all …]
|
| H A D | mouse.c | 19 vterm_push_output_sprintf_ctrl(state->vt, C1_CSI, "M%c%c%c", in output_mouse() 35 vterm_push_output_sprintf_ctrl(state->vt, C1_CSI, "M%s", utf8); in output_mouse() 40 vterm_push_output_sprintf_ctrl(state->vt, C1_CSI, "<%d;%d;%d%c", in output_mouse() 48 vterm_push_output_sprintf_ctrl(state->vt, C1_CSI, "%d;%d;%dM", in output_mouse() 54 void vterm_mouse_move(VTerm *vt, int row, int col, VTermModifier mod) in vterm_mouse_move() argument 56 VTermState *state = vt->state; in vterm_mouse_move() 73 void vterm_mouse_button(VTerm *vt, int button, int pressed, VTermModifier mod) in vterm_mouse_button() argument 75 VTermState *state = vt->state; in vterm_mouse_button()
|
| H A D | screen.c | 43 VTerm *vt; member 699 static VTermScreen *screen_new(VTerm *vt) in screen_new() argument 701 VTermState *state = vterm_obtain_state(vt); in screen_new() 711 vterm_get_size(vt, &rows, &cols); in screen_new() 713 screen->vt = vt; in screen_new() 750 vterm_allocator_free(screen->vt, screen); in vterm_screen_free() 897 VTermScreen *vterm_obtain_screen(VTerm *vt) in vterm_obtain_screen() argument 899 if(!vt->screen) in vterm_obtain_screen() 900 vt->screen = screen_new(vt); in vterm_obtain_screen() 901 return vt->screen; in vterm_obtain_screen() [all …]
|
| H A D | vterm_internal.h | 63 VTerm *vt; member 244 void *vterm_allocator_malloc(VTerm *vt, size_t size); 245 void vterm_allocator_free(VTerm *vt, void *ptr); 247 void vterm_push_output_bytes(VTerm *vt, const char *bytes, size_t len); 248 void vterm_push_output_vsprintf(VTerm *vt, const char *format, va_list args); 249 void vterm_push_output_sprintf(VTerm *vt, const char *format, ...); 250 void vterm_push_output_sprintf_ctrl(VTerm *vt, unsigned char ctrl, const char *fmt, ...); 251 void vterm_push_output_sprintf_dcs(VTerm *vt, const char *fmt, ...);
|
| /vim-8.2.3635/src/libvterm/include/ |
| H A D | vterm.h | 309 void vterm_free(VTerm* vt); 314 void vterm_set_size(VTerm *vt, int rows, int cols); 316 int vterm_get_utf8(const VTerm *vt); 317 void vterm_set_utf8(VTerm *vt, int is_utf8); 327 size_t vterm_output_get_buffer_size(const VTerm *vt); 334 int vterm_is_modify_other_keys(VTerm *vt); 338 void vterm_keyboard_start_paste(VTerm *vt); 339 void vterm_keyboard_end_paste(VTerm *vt); 382 void *vterm_parser_get_cbdata(VTerm *vt); 424 VTermState *vterm_obtain_state(VTerm *vt); [all …]
|
| /vim-8.2.3635/src/libvterm/t/ |
| H A D | harness.c | 83 static VTerm *vt; variable 541 if(!vt) in main() 542 vt = vterm_new(25, 80); in main() 556 state = vterm_obtain_state(vt); in main() 599 screen = vterm_obtain_screen(vt); in main() 637 vterm_set_utf8(vt, flag); in main() 656 vterm_set_size(vt, rows, cols); in main() 719 vterm_keyboard_key(vt, key, mod); in main() 725 vterm_keyboard_start_paste(vt); in main() 727 vterm_keyboard_end_paste(vt); in main() [all …]
|
| /vim-8.2.3635/src/VisVim/ |
| H A D | OleAut.cpp | 267 if (! (s = GetNextVarType (s, &p->vt))) in Invoke() 275 switch (p->vt) in Invoke() 299 p->vt = VT_EMPTY; in Invoke() 393 switch (p->vt) in Invoke()
|
| /vim-8.2.3635/runtime/autoload/ |
| H A D | netrw.vim | 1643 fun! s:NetrwOptionsSave(vt) argument 1645 " call Decho(a:vt."netrw_optionsave".(exists("{a:vt}netrw_optionsave")? ("=".{a:vt}netrw_optionsav… 1650 let {a:vt}netrw_optionsave= 1 1711 " call Decho("saving to ".a:vt."netrw_dirkeep<".{a:vt}netrw_dirkeep.">",'~'.expand("<slnum>")) 1788 fun! s:NetrwOptionsRestore(vt) argument 1801 unlet {a:vt}netrw_optionsave 1808 unlet {a:vt}netrw_acdkeep 1867 if exists("{a:vt}netrw_swfkeep") 1875 unlet {a:vt}netrw_swfkeep 1881 unlet {a:vt}netrw_swfkeep [all …]
|
| H A D | haskellcomplete.vim | 1137 \ , "-ddump-vt-trace"
|
| /vim-8.2.3635/runtime/spell/af/ |
| H A D | af_ZA.diff | 33 - vt
|
| /vim-8.2.3635/runtime/syntax/ |
| H A D | obj.vim | 51 syn match objVertice "^vt\s"
|
| H A D | terminfo.vim | 33 \ ncv nlab pb vt wsl bitwin bitype bufsz btns
|
| H A D | mush.vim | 182 syntax keyword mushAttribute vo vp vq vr vs vt vu vv vw vx vy vz
|
| H A D | aml.vim | 53 …ta status stc std str straightenangle straightencorner straightendistance straightenrange vt vtrace
|
| H A D | clojure.vim | 108 …nagh|rh%(uta)?|b%(t|etan))|fng|glg|a%(i_%(le|tham|viet)|g%(alog|b%(anwa)?)|vt|kri?|ng%(ut)?|l[ue]|…
|
| /vim-8.2.3635/runtime/ftplugin/ |
| H A D | context.vim | 100 onoremap <silent><buffer> i$ :<c-u>normal! T$vt$<cr>
|
| /vim-8.2.3635/runtime/ |
| H A D | termcap | 53 :ho=\E[H:k1=\EOP:k2=\EOQ:k3=\EOR:k4=\EOS:pt:sr=5\EM:vt#3:xn:\
|
| /vim-8.2.3635/src/testdir/ |
| H A D | gen_opt_test.vim | 102 \ 'formatoptions': [['', 'vt', 'v,t'], ['xxx']],
|
| H A D | test_textformat.vim | 1051 setlocal formatoptions=vt
|
| H A D | test_options.vim | 1134 call assert_equal('vt', &formatoptions)
|
| /vim-8.2.3635/runtime/doc/ |
| H A D | options.txt | 1835 'formatoptions' & "vt" Vi compatible formatting 3589 'formatoptions' 'fo' string (Vim default: "tcq", Vi default: "vt")
|